Hazing Cane

Hazing Cane pours a hazy, golden yellow color. Head is white, frothy, one finger thick, and recedes down but leaves generous lacing. Mild aroma of citrus, tropical fruit, and biscuity malts. Taste is similar, with light citrus, greater amounts of tropical fruit, and just a touch of bitterness. Nice use of Double Dry Hopping to bring out the hop flavors. Light body, soft mouthfeel, with moderate carbonation. There's a surprising caramel malt sweetness that shows up in the finish. Easy drinking and quite enjoyable.
